Pay: £25,000.00 - £60,000.00 per year

Job Description:

Join Team Ortel as a Door to Door Field Sales Executive selling EE & BT Group Broadband Products

  • £25k Base Salary + £250 car allowance & up to £250 travel expenses!
  • £40,000 – £60,000+ OTE
  • Uncapped Commission + additional bonus and incentives
  • Earn big with flexible working options selling award-winning home broadband products. We’re expanding and looking for confident, target-driven individuals to sell EE & BT broadband door-to-door in residential areas.

This high-performance field sales role offers strong earning potential, including a basic salary (hourly paid) + uncapped commission.

  • Realistic OTE £40,000–£60,000+ (our top performers earn more!)
  • Minimum 16 paid hours per week initially, increasing up to 37.5 hours based on performance.
  • Experienced door-to-door sales people may be offered full-time positions (37.5 hours) starting on day one.
  • Permanent role.
  • Immediate starts available.

The Role:

  • Door-to-door residential sales
  • Promote EE & BT products
  • Hit targets and maximise earnings

Commission & Bonus Structure:

  • Earn commission on EVERY SALE from your first sale.
  • Higher value products = higher commission
  • Threshold: 15 net sales per month required to unlock commission
  • Once achieved, commission is paid on all sales (1–15+)
  • Bonuses:
    • 20+ sales = additional bonus
      • Example: 28 sales = +£500 | 38 sales = +£1,000
    • Quarterly bonus for consistent performance

Quality:

  • We will monitor and address high cancellation rates in line with company policies.
  • We actively encourage upselling our product range based solely on customer needs; this is monitored both internally by our compliance team and externally through NPS metrics.

We’re looking for:

  • 18+ and eligible to work in the UK
  • Confident, resilient, target-driven
  • Comfortable working outdoors
  • Driving licence preferred (not essential)
  • Door to Door Sales experience is beneficial, but attitude is key.

What do you get?

  • Paid training & reduced targets during onboarding
  • EE / BT uniform + Samsung tablet
  • Staff discounts on EE Mobile Phones & Home Broadband
  • 20 days holiday + bank holidays (pro rata)
  • Pension scheme
  • £250+ referral bonus
  • Incentives, rewards & social events
